body {
	background: #FC9900;
	margin: 0px;
	padding: 0px;
	font: 11px Verdana, Arial, Helvetica, sans-serif;
}
table {
	padding:0px;
	margin:0px;
}
td {
	padding:0px;
	vertical-align:top;
}
.outertable {
	width: 100%;
	margin-top: 10px;
}
.centercolumn {
	width: 726px;
	background: #6B9CFF url(images/bgr_bubblesblue_right.gif) repeat-y right top;
}
.leftcolumn {
	background: url(images/bgr_left.jpg) repeat-y right top;
}
.rightcolumn {
	background: url(images/bgr_right.jpg) repeat-y left top;
}
.address {
	float: left;
	height: 175px;
	width: 212px;
	line-height: 12px;
	color: #0000FF;
	margin: 0px;
	padding: 0px;
}
.address a:link {
	color: #0000FF;
	text-decoration:none;
}	
.address a:visited {
	color: #0000FF;
	text-decoration:none;
}
.address a:hover {
	color: #0000FF;
	text-decoration:underline;
}			
.booking {
	background: #000000 url(images/bgr_booking.gif) no-repeat right top;
	float: left;
	height: 175px;
	width: 164px;
	padding: 0px;
}
div {
	margin: 0px;
	padding: 0px;
	border: none;
}
.logo {
	float: left;
	height: 175px;
	width: 350px;
	position: relative;
}
.addressposition {
	margin-top: 10px;
	margin-left: 15px;
}
.insideleft {
	height: 539px;
	width: 350px;
	float: left;
}
.menu {
	float: right;
	width: 142px;
}
.menuenglish {
	float: right;
	width: 165px;
}
.insideright {
	float: left;
	padding: 0px;
	width: 376px;
}
.paddingtext {
	padding-top: 30px;
	padding-left: 20px;
	line-height: 22px;
	font-size: 12px;
	padding-right: 20px;
	color: #FFFFFF;
}
.paddingtext a:link {
	color: #FFFFFF;
	text-decoration:none;
}
.paddingtext a:visited {
	color: #FFFFFF;
	text-decoration:none;
}
.paddingtext a:hover {
	color: #FFFFFF;
	text-decoration:underline;
}
.imagesright {
	float: right;
	width: 164px;
	margin-left: 20px;
}
.imagesright a:link {
	color:#FFFFFF;
	text-decoration:underline;
}
.imagesright a:visited {
	color:#FFFFFF;
	text-decoration:underline;
}
.imagesright a:hover {
	color:#FF9900;
	text-decoration:underline;
}
li {
	margin: 0px 0px 0px 23px;
	padding: 0px;
}
ul {
	margin: 0px;
	padding: 0px;
}
.language {
	font: normal 12px Verdana, Arial, Helvetica, sans-serif;
	color: #0000CC;
	margin-bottom: 50px;
}
.language a:link {
	color: #0000CC;
	text-decoration:none;
}
.language a:visited {
	color: #0000CC;
	text-decoration:none;
}
.language a:hover {
	color:#000000;
	text-decoration:none;
}

#fb{
    height: 45px;
    left: 25px;
    position: absolute;
    width: 82px;
	top: 10px;	
	}
#fb a img{
	border:none;
	margin-bottom: 7px;
	}	
.down {
	width:700px;
	position:relative;
	left:-330px;
	line-height: 22px;
	font-size: 12px;
	color: white;
}
.down a:link {
	color:#FFF;
	text-decoration:none;
	
}
.down a:hover {
	text-decoration:underline;	
}
.footer {
	width:700px;
	position:relative;
	left:-330px;
	line-height: 22px;
	font-size: 12px;
	color: white;
	text-align:center;
	border-top:1px solid white;
	padding: 10px 0 10px 0;
}
.footer a:link {
	color:#FFF;
	text-decoration:none;
	
}
.footer a:hover {
	text-decoration:underline;	
}

a:visited {
	color:white;	
}
table .hostal-barato  {
	text-align:center;
}
/*--- Principio Contenedor del motor de reservas ---*/
#mirai_bookentrance {
	width:200px;
	position:relative;
	left:562px;
	top:10px;
}


#mirai_be0, #mirai_be2, #mirai_be0 input, #mirai_be0 select { /*#mirai_be2, #mirai_be0 input, #mirai_be0 select para que se vea la misma letra en IE6 y IE7*/
    /*font-family: Verdana;*/
    font-size: 12px;
	
}
#mirai_be0 {
    /*width:13.7em;*/
    /*height:11.5em;*/
}
/*--- Fin Contenedor del motor de reservas ---*/
/*--- Principio Posición de elementos ---*/
#mirai_be1, #mirai_be3 { /* Espacio a la izquierda para "Entrada" y "Noches" y margin para igualar horizontalmente con textos de los input */
    /*left:0;*/
    /*margin-top:0.25em;*/
	color:#FFF;
}
#mirai_be2, #mirai_be4, #mirai_be6 { /* Espacio a la izquierda para "Input Entrada", "Input Noches", y "Input Codigo Promocional" */
    /*left:6.5em;*/
}
#mirai_be7, #mirai_be8 { /* Espacio a la izquierda para "Input Reservar", "Input Ver/Cancelar" */
    /*left:0;*/
}
#mirai_be1, #mirai_be2 { /* Espacio superior para "Entrada" y "Input Entrada" */
    /*top: 0; */
}
#mirai_be3, #mirai_be4 { /* Espacio superior para "Noches" y "Input Noches" */
    /*top:2.2em;*/
}
#mirai_be5 { /* Espacio superior y a la izquierda para "Codigo Promocional" */
    /*top: 6.15em;*/
    /*left: 0em;*/
	color:#FFF;
}
#mirai_be6 { /* Espacio superior para "Input Codigo promocional" */
    /*top:4.6em;*/
}
#mirai_be7 { /* Espacio a la izquierda y superior para "Input Reservar" */
    /*top: 6.9em;*/
    /*left:0;*/
	
}
#mirai_be8 { /* Espacio a la izquierda y superior para "Input Ver/Cancelar" */
    /*top: 9.9em;*/
    /*left:0;*/
}
/*--- Fin Posición de elementos ---*/
/*--- Principio Estilos de Botones y Codigo Promocional ---*/
#mirai_be2, #mirai_be6 { /* Anchura para "Input Entrada" y "Input Codigo Promocional" */
    /*width:7em;*/
}
#mirai_be2, #mirai_be4, #mirai_be6 { /* Estilos "Input Entrada", "Input Noches" y "Input Codigo Promocional" */
     /*background-color:#FFFFFE;*/ /* para que el "color" de < slect > en Safari funciona, no se pudede asignar #FFFFFF. Color de letra para Text Inputs */
     /*border:1px solid #999;*/
     /* color: #444;*/
    }
#mirai_be5 { /*--- Texto "Codigo Promocional" ---*/
    /*font-size: 0.75em;*/
    /*line-height: 0.9em;*/
    /*width: 3em;*/
}
#mirai_be7 input { /*--- Boton "Input Reservar" ---*/
    background-color:#FC9900;
	padding: 0.2em 1.1em;
	color:#FFF;
}
#mirai_be7 input:hover { /*--- Boton "Input Reservar Hover" ---*/
    /*---*/
}
#mirai_be8 { /*--- Boton "Input Ver/Cancelar" ---*/
    text-decoration:none;
	font-weight:bold;
   color:#FFF;
}
#mirai_be8:hover { /*--- Boton "Input Ver/Cancelar" ---*/
   color:#FC9900;
   text-decoration:underline;
}
/*--- Fin Estilos de Botones y Codigo Promocional ---*/
/*--- Principio Para que el calendario aparezca siempre encima ---*/
#ui-datepicker-div {
    /*font-size:0.8em;*/
	left: 544px!important;
}
/*--- Fin Para que el calendario aparezca siempre encima ---*/#blog {
	color:#000;
	font-size:18px;
	text-decoration:none;
	font-family: "Comic Sans MS";
	padding-left: 95px;
}
#blog:hover {
	text-decoration:underline;
}

